Many people have never heard of Japan's "comfort women" system during WWII. Here are five key facts about this shocking practice. #LastDaughters
1. The "wartime comfort women" were victims of sexual slavery by the Japanese military during #WWII.
2. Per estimates, at least 400,000 women globally were forced into sexual slavery by the Japanese military.
3. They were mostly from China, the Korean Peninsula, the Philippines, Myanmar, Malaysia and the Netherlands. Half of the victims – some 200,000 – were from China.
4. These women endured horrific conditions, including repeated rape, beatings and torture. Many did not survive, with some estimates suggesting a 90 percent death rate.
5. Survivors and advocates are still waiting for a formal apology and legal reparations from the Japanese government.
